Route Description

Everything you need to know about the corridor Sacramento - Trenton

The logistics corridor connecting Sacramento, California, to Trenton, New Jersey, spans approximately 3,973 kilometers across the United States. This transcontinental route represents a critical east-west transportation artery, linking the West Coast's economic powerhouse with the bustling industrial centers of the Northeast. The corridor traverses diverse geographical regions and passes through major metropolitan areas, making it a vital link for domestic freight movement across the country.

The Sacramento-Trenton corridor serves numerous industries that require reliable cross-country transportation. From California's technology hubs and agricultural centers to New Jersey's pharmaceutical and manufacturing clusters, this route facilitates the movement of high-value electronics, agricultural products, automotive components, and industrial machinery. The corridor particularly benefits from California's robust export economy and New Jersey's position as a gateway to the Northeast market.

This extensive route primarily utilizes Interstate 80, which runs from San Francisco through Sacramento and continues across the country to New York City, just north of Trenton. The highway system provides excellent infrastructure for full truckload (FTL) freight transportation, with multiple lanes, rest areas, and service centers along the way. Sacramento Origin

Sacramento, the capital of California, serves as a strategic logistics hub on the West Coast. Located in the fertile Central Valley, Sacramento benefits from its proximity to major ports, agricultural regions, and technology centers in Northern California. The city's transportation infrastructure includes excellent highway connections via I-80 and I-5, rail networks, and proximity to the Port of Oakland. Sacramento's economy is diverse, with strong sectors in government, healthcare, technology, and agriculture, creating consistent demand for freight transportation services. The region's agricultural output, including fresh produce and processed foods, frequently requires reliable cross-country transportation to reach markets in the eastern United States.

Trenton Destination

Trenton, New Jersey, is strategically positioned in the Northeast Corridor, offering exceptional access to major markets including New York City, Philadelphia, and the entire Eastern Seaboard. As the capital of New Jersey, Trenton benefits from its location within one of the nation's most densely populated and economically active regions. The area features a robust transportation network including I-95, I-295, and extensive rail connections. Trenton's proximity to major ports, international airports, and industrial centers makes it an ideal destination for cross-country freight. The region's economy is anchored by pharmaceuticals, telecommunications, manufacturing, and professional services, all of which rely on efficient supply chain solutions to maintain their competitive edge.
